Name: Condado das Vinhas
Type: Red
Grape: Blend
Origin: Portugal
Year: 2004
Producer: Herdade Grande
Price: $8.49

This Portugese blend is from the Trincadeira, Aragones and Alfrocheiro grapes. Fairly obscure stuff. It's ruby red with an aroma of leather and oak. It starts with a berry flavor but quickly moves on to a smooth but tannic finish that is medium in length. I find it to be a very nice red. It would be better with food but is enjoyable even on its own.
